In accordance with the Texas Open Meetings Act, if a citizen discusses any item not on the agenda, City Council cannot discuss issues raised or make any decision at this time. Instead, City Council is limited to making a statement of specific factual information or a recitation of existing policy in response to the inquiry. Issues may be referred to City Manager for research and possible future action. Consider action to approve Resolution No. R-2022-54 of the City Council of the City of Bastrop, Texas, approving a construction contract with SJ Louis Construction of Texas, LTD of San Antonio, Texas for the Westside Collection System Phase 2 to an amount of Four Million Four Hundred Eighty-Five Thousand Nine Hundred Forty-Four Dollars and Seventeen Cents ($4,485,944.17); authorizing the City Manager to execute all necessary documents; providing for a repealing clause; and establishing an effective date.
